One significant factor contributing to the resurgence of classic TV shows is the timeless charm they evoke. Many people who grew up in the olden days still have a strong attachment to shows from their childhood. As a result, streaming platforms have capitalised on this wistfulness by offering a vast library of classic TV shows, including sitcoms such as "The Golden Girls", "Friends", and "The Big Bang Theory", as well as dramas like "Bones" and "Buffy the Vampire Slayer".


Beyond nostalgic appeal, classic TV shows are also being remade for new audiences. This phenomenon, known as the 'retro remake', has seen classic shows refreshed with modern twists. For instance, the recent remake of "Charlie's Angels" featured a diverse cast and a innovative take on the original series. This approach has proven effective in introducing classic shows to new generations.


Streaming platforms have also made it easier for classic TV shows to be widely accessible. Gone are the days of searching thrift stores for outdated media or waiting for reruns on TV. With streaming services, users can access classic shows at a convenient moment and place that suits them. This has opened up a new world of possibilities for fans of vintage content, allowing them to rediscover old favourites or introduce friends and family to classic shows.


However, it's not just the classic shows themselves that have made a comeback. The digital age has also enabled fans to engage with each other around their shared love of retro programming. Online forums, social media groups, and websites dedicated to classic TV shows provide a space for fans to discuss their favourite shows, share memories, and connect with like-minded individuals.


Furthermore, the digital age has also made it easier for classic TV shows to receive the recognition they deserve. With the rise of streaming services, shows that may have been overlooked in the past can now gain a wider following. For instance, the popular streaming service "Tubi" has featured obscure retro shows such as "Magnum P.I." and "Knight Rider".


In conclusion, the digital age has brought about a new era of classic TV shows. Nostalgia continues to drive interest in vintage content, while the retro remake phenomenon has introduced classic shows to new audiences. Streaming platforms have made it easier than ever for fans to access classic shows, and social media has enabled fans to connect with one another around their shared love of retro programming. As a result, classic TV shows are experiencing a resurgence, and it's clear that their popularity will continue to thrive.
